Python is an ideal first language because it's easy to learn, widely used, versatile, and opens the door to many areas of technology. Starting with Python helps build a solid foundation for a long-term programming journey.Python is often recommended as the first programming language for beginners,because, 1. Simple and Readable SyntaxPython's syntax is clean and close to plain English, which makes it easier to understand and write, especially for beginners. You don't need to worry about complex punctuation or boilerplate code just to get started.Compare that to Java or C++, which require more setup even for simple tasks.2. Widely Used and In-DemandPython is one of the most popular programming languages today, used in industries like:Web developmentData scienceMachine learningAutomationCybersecurityGame developmentLearning Python first means you're starting with a language that has practical, real-world applications and excellent job prospects.3. Large Supportive CommunityPython has a massive global community. For beginners, this means:Tons of tutorials and coursesActive forums like Stack Overflow and RedditAbundant libraries and toolsYou're never alone when you get stuck.4. Great for Learning Programming ConceptsPython helps you understand core programming ideas such as:Variables and data typesLoops and conditionalsFunctionsObject-oriented programmingThese concepts are transferable to almost any other language, making it easier to pick up Java, C++, or JavaScript later.5. Versatility and Cross-Platform CompatibilityPython works on all major operating systems (Windows, macOS, Linux) and is used in everything from basic scripts to complex systems. As a beginner, you can experiment across a wide range of fields without switching languages.6.
